What Mold Types Are Most Dangerous to Humans?
When you find mold in your home, it’s natural to worry about its impact on your health. Not all molds are created equal, but some pose much greater health risks than others. Understanding these dangerous types can help you take the right steps to protect your family.
The Culprits: Mycotoxin-Producing Molds
The primary danger from certain molds comes from substances they produce called mycotoxins. These are toxic compounds that can cause a variety of adverse health effects. Many experts say that the presence of mycotoxins is what elevates a mold from a nuisance to a serious threat.
Stachybotrys Chartarum (True Black Mold)
This is the mold most people think of when they hear “black mold.” While other molds can appear black, Stachybotrys chartarum is particularly concerning because it produces potent mycotoxins. These toxins can be inhaled or ingested, leading to respiratory problems and other symptoms.
Research shows that prolonged exposure to Stachybotrys spores and mycotoxins can be harmful to the immune system. It’s often found on water-damaged cellulose-rich materials like drywall, wood, and paper. If you suspect you have mold growth after hidden moisture, it’s important to act quickly.
Aspergillus Species
Aspergillus is a very common mold genus, with many different species. While some are harmless, others, like Aspergillus flavus and Aspergillus niger, can produce mycotoxins. These molds are frequently found in dust, soil, and decaying vegetation. In homes, they can grow on foods, damp fabrics, and walls.
For individuals with weakened immune systems, or those with allergies, Aspergillus can cause serious infections, known as aspergillosis. Even for healthy people, inhaling spores can trigger allergic reactions and asthma attacks.
Penicillium Species
You might recognize the name Penicillium from the antibiotic. However, some species of this mold also produce mycotoxins. Penicillium thrives in cooler, damp conditions and is often found on water-damaged materials, including carpets, insulation, and wallpaper. It’s also a common cause of food spoilage.
Exposure can lead to allergic reactions and asthma. For those with sensitivities, it can cause lung inflammation. It’s a common reason for musty odors from concealed mold, signaling a problem that needs attention.
Cladosporium Species
Cladosporium is another common mold found both indoors and outdoors. It typically appears in shades of green or brown. While not as notorious for mycotoxins as Stachybotrys, it can still cause allergic reactions, asthma attacks, and skin irritation. It often grows on surfaces like window frames, textiles, and painted walls.
This mold can be an indicator of poor indoor air quality. Its presence often means there’s a moisture issue that needs to be addressed to prevent further growth.
Health Risks Associated with Dangerous Molds
The health effects of mold exposure vary widely. They depend on the type of mold, the amount of exposure, and individual sensitivity. Some people are much more susceptible than others, particularly children and the elderly.
Common symptoms include:
- Sneezing and runny nose
- Red or itchy eyes
- Skin rash
- Wheezing and shortness of breath
- Asthma attacks
More severe reactions can include:
- Fever and chills
- Nausea and vomiting
- Headaches and fatigue
- Neurological problems
- Severe respiratory infections
It’s important to remember that even if a mold isn’t producing mycotoxins, high concentrations of any mold spores can cause adverse health effects. This is especially true if you have allergies or asthma.
Vulnerable Populations
Certain groups are at higher risk from mold exposure. This includes infants, children, the elderly, and individuals with existing respiratory conditions like asthma or allergies. People with weakened immune systems, such as those with HIV/AIDS, cancer, or organ transplant recipients, are also at increased risk.

Identifying and Assessing Mold Dangers
Spotting mold visually is often the first sign of trouble. However, not all mold is visible. Sometimes, the only indicator is a persistent musty odor. This can signal mold growth within walls or under flooring. It’s crucial to address these hidden mold concerns promptly.
Knowing what surfaces are most susceptible to mold growth can help you inspect common problem areas. Porous materials like drywall, wood, and insulation are prime targets.
| Mold Type | Potential Mycotoxins | Common Locations | Primary Health Concerns |
|---|---|---|---|
| Stachybotrys Chartarum | Trichothecenes | Water-damaged drywall, wood, paper | Respiratory distress, allergic reactions, neurological issues |
| Aspergillus | Aflatoxins, Ochratoxins | Damp fabrics, foods, walls | Allergic reactions, asthma, infections (in immunocompromised) |
| Penicillium | Ochratoxins, Citrinin | Water-damaged carpets, insulation, wallpaper | Allergic reactions, lung inflammation |
| Cladosporium | Limited mycotoxin production, but allergenic | Window frames, textiles, painted surfaces | Allergic reactions, asthma, skin irritation |
A professional mold assessment is the best way to determine the type and extent of mold contamination. This process goes beyond a simple visual inspection. The Role of Moisture and Water Damage
Mold needs moisture to grow. Any source of water intrusion can lead to mold problems. This includes leaks from roofs, pipes, or windows. High humidity levels can also create the perfect environment for mold.
Areas prone to water damage include bathrooms, kitchens, basements, and attics. If you experience flooding or significant leaks, it’s essential to address the water damage immediately. Ignoring it can lead to extensive mold growth and structural damage.

Preventing Dangerous Mold Growth
The best defense against dangerous mold is prevention. Controlling moisture in your home is key. Here are some practical steps:
Mold Prevention Checklist:
- Fix any leaks promptly.
- Ensure good ventilation in bathrooms and kitchens.
- Use dehumidifiers in damp areas.
- Clean and dry any water-damaged areas within 24-48 hours.
- Monitor humidity levels, aiming for 30-50%.
- Regularly inspect areas prone to moisture.
These steps can significantly reduce the chances of mold taking hold. If you do notice signs of mold, it’s important not to wait to get help. Early intervention can prevent the problem from becoming severe.

What are the first signs of dangerous mold?
The first signs of dangerous mold can be a musty or earthy odor, visible mold growth (which can be black, green, white, or other colors), or unexplained health symptoms like persistent allergies or respiratory issues. Pay attention to any damp or musty smells, especially after water damage.
Can mold cause long-term health problems?
Yes, research shows that prolonged exposure to certain molds, especially those producing mycotoxins, can lead to long-term health problems. These can include chronic respiratory issues, asthma, and in some cases, more severe neurological or immune system effects.
How quickly can mold become dangerous?
Mold can begin to grow within 24-48 hours of a water event. While it may not immediately become “dangerous,” the longer mold is allowed to grow and spread, the higher the concentration of spores and potentially mycotoxins in the air, increasing health risks. Act before it gets worse.
